Based on e+e- collision data corresponding to an integrated luminosity of 4.5 fb-1 collected at the center-of-mass energies between 4.600 and 4.699 GeV with the BESIII detector at BEPCII, the absolute branching fraction of the inclusive decay Λ¯c-→n¯+X, where X refers to any possible final state particles, is measured. The absolute branching fraction is determined to be B(Λ¯c-→n¯+X)=(32.4±0.7±1.5)%, where the first uncertainty is statistical and the second systematic. Assuming CP symmetry, the measurement indicates that about one fourth of Λc+ (Λ¯c-) decay modes with a neutron (an antineutron) in the final state have not been observed.
